The 30-Second Verdict

Updated

In Mill Valley, CA, your best bet is AT&T, covering about 92% of the city overall. Its fastest FCC-filed tier reaches speeds up to 5,000 Mbps, while AT&T fiber reaches 54% of the city. Xfinity is a close citywide alternative at 95.2% coverage, though its 2000/300 Mbps cable tier reaches 47% of the city. In Tamalpais Park, AT&T fiber leads at 67.8% of the ZIP, while Xfinity’s 1200/35 Mbps cable reaches 17.6% and its 2000/300 Mbps tier reaches 13.2%. ZIP 94942 also favors AT&T fiber at 55.3%, with Xfinity’s 1200/35 Mbps tier reaching 34.2% and its 2000/300 Mbps tier reaching 10.5%, making the cable footprint there look more limited. Sycamore Park, Boyle Park, and Cascade Canyon deserve the same street-level check rather than assumptions based on broader city numbers. Unwired Ltd is the broadest fixed-wireless alternative, reaching 84% with speeds up to 300/25 Mbps, while T-Mobile reaches 37% with speeds up to 100/20 Mbps and Verizon reaches 36% with speeds up to 300/20 Mbps. Coverage changes street to street, so confirm the exact address before choosing.

How We Calculate Speed Score

Our Speed Score is a state-level percentile ranking (0-100) that shows how a provider’s service compares to all other internet options available in your state.

The Formula:

We calculate a raw performance score using:

Technology Factor × (Download Speed × 70% + Upload Speed × 30%)

Technology Factors:

Not all connections are equal. We weight each technology based on real-world reliability and performance:

  • Fiber: 100% – Fastest, most reliable technology
  • Cable: 85% – High speeds, shared neighborhood bandwidth
  • Fixed Wireless (Licensed): 70% – Dedicated spectrum, weather-dependent
  • Copper/DSL: 65% – Distance-limited, aging infrastructure
  • Fixed Wireless (Unlicensed): 60% – Shared spectrum, variable performance
  • Satellite (LEO): 40% – Low-earth orbit (e.g., Starlink), higher latency
  • Satellite (GEO): 15% – Geostationary orbit, significant latency

Percentile Ranking:

After calculating raw scores, we rank every service option in your state by geographic coverage (census blocks served). A score of 85 means this service performs better than 85% of all internet options available in your state.

Data Source: FCC National Broadband Map data, updated twice a year.

How We Calculate Capabilities

Estimated Capabilities predict how well each internet plan supports common household activities based on speed requirements and connection type.

Rating Scale:

  • Excellent – Optimal performance, handles peak usage easily
  • Good – Reliable performance with minimal issues
  • Fair – Functional but may experience slowdowns during heavy use
  • Poor – Not recommended; expect frequent buffering or lag

How We Rate Each Category:

Streaming

Based on download speed. 4K streaming requires 25+ Mbps per stream; HD requires 5+ Mbps. We account for multiple simultaneous streams.

Multi-device

Evaluates total bandwidth capacity divided by typical household device count (phones, tablets, smart TVs, computers). Fiber and cable handle many devices better than DSL or satellite.

Gaming

Considers both upload speed (for sending game data) and latency (ping time). Fiber and cable excel here; satellite connections struggle due to inherent signal delay.

Whole Home

Assesses whether the connection can reliably serve an entire household during peak evening hours. Factors in technology type (shared vs. dedicated bandwidth) and total speed capacity.

Note: Actual performance depends on your specific location, network congestion, and equipment quality.
